How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 90831?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
90831 Studio Apartments | $2,001 | $975 | $3,545 |
90831 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,633 | $685 | $5,995 |
90831 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,505 | $500 | $9,399 |
90831 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,158 | $1,400 | $10,000+ |
90831 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,604 | $3,375 | $5,500 |
